Ep54 - Parasites in marine snails

from Behind The Science Podcast · host Behind the Science Podcast and The Pod Network Entertainment

Mr. Sandy Rey Bradecina, an associate professor at Central Bicol State University and a PhD student at Kochi University, discusses his research on parasites called trematodes found in marine snails. He explains the complex life cycle of these parasites, their potential impact on both marine organisms and humans, and how they can spread through various hosts, including snails, fish, and birds. He also shares insights into his academic journey, challenges in field research, and the importance of parasite awareness for public health.
